Output 57628859fa969545653b270eea87c4e5f48da9e4f4fcda7571d8b7edcb5155e5:1

value
12046627
script pubkey
OP_0 OP_PUSHBYTES_20 cae2e0a30b8119b5aa16e1c3bf2edaa8b57fdbbf
address
bc1qet3wpgctsyvmt2sku8pm7tk64z6hlkaljvg3d2
transaction
57628859fa969545653b270eea87c4e5f48da9e4f4fcda7571d8b7edcb5155e5
spent
true